Ninth Extraordinary Session of the Islamic Summit Conference. The Ninth Extraordinary Session of the Islamic Summit Conference was organized by the Organization of Islamic Cooperation (OIC) in response to the 2023 Israel–Hamas war. The meeting took place on 18 October 2023 at the General Secretariat headquarters in Jeddah, Saudi Arabia.

Iran and Saudi Arabia have waged a proxy war in Libya, with Saudi Arabia, [485] along with the U.A.E, [486] Egypt, and Sudan, have provided support to the Libyan National Army, and its leader warlord Khalifa Haftar. Iran, Qatar, and Turkey support the Government of National Accord and other Islamist forces in the country.
